OverviewAn equipment and fleet administrator is not your typical admin position. The Equipment and Fleet Administrator will track, inventory, and keep track of services and inspections on all company vehicles and equipment in the Western region. This position will also assist with permitting for the Western Region heavy haul trucks. Will also assist with reports for mobile machinery decals and vehicle registration.
This person will also fill in for scale personnel when they are out. The Equipment and Fleet Administrator will be based out of the Sundance Office. It is a full-time position that reports to the Equipment Manager.

- Use software systems to manage and track vehicles or equipment.
- Monitor equipment locations and make arrangements to move equipment throughout the company.
- Strong knowledge of various types of equipment (redi‑mix trucks, loaders, dump trucks, backhoes, semi‑trailers, aggregate crushers, etc.).
- Oversee vehicle documents, including permits, DMV registration, and insurance certificates.
- Record any maintenance issues and ensure the supervisor is aware of any maintenance issues that would inhibit work production or create safety concerns.
- Coordinate vehicle and equipment inspections regularly to comply with safety standards.
- Coordinate field and shop managers to schedule vehicle and equipment preventative maintenance.
- Develop and maintain strong working relationships with vendors, suppliers, and field managers.
- Analyze the equipment utilization and make recommendations to management on requests from the field.
